body, #page-wrapper, #page, #main-wrapper, #main, #content, #content .section {
    background-color: transparent !important;
    background-image: none !important;
    color: #000000 !important;
}
body {
    width: 100% !important;
}
h1, h2, h3, h4, h5, h6, p, a {
    color: #000000 !important;
}
.structBody a {
    color: #000000 !important;}

#ContentBreadCrumbs,
.structHead,
.structFooter2,
#ContentBreadCrumbsColor,
#ContentBreadCrumbsColor2,
.structLeft,
.structRight,
.structFooter{display:none!important;}

#preview-message {display:none;}

body,html,form,
.fltFix{ background: transparent!important;}


.structBody {
display:block !important;
margin:0 !important;
background:#FFF!important;
width:100% !important;
}
.structBody .print{display:block!important;}

.Accordion{ page-break-before:auto;}

.AccordionPanelContent {	display: block !important;height: auto!important;}

.structBody .cntrWrap{width:100%;}

.clearBoth{ display:none!important;}

.MidWrap{ float:none!important; width:100%!important;}

.gryTab .AccordionPanelTab, .gryTab .AccordionPanelContent {background-color:#FFF!important;}

#ContentMiddle{ width:100%!important;}

#ContentPageNameLg{ width:100%!important;}
